1. Centre asks states not to put restrictions on inter-state movement of people, goods

The Centre has asked all states to ensure that there should be no restrictions on the inter-state and intra-state movement of persons and goods during the ongoing unlocking process.

2. UP: Mother out of work due to COVID-19, 5-yr-old dies of starvation

In a heart-wrenching incident, a five-year-old girl from Uttar Pradesh's Agra district died of starvation as her family did not have any source of income owing to the COVID-19 situation.

3. SC grants CBI court another month to pronounce verdict in Babri mosque demolition case

The Supreme Court has once again extended the deadline for the CBI court to pronounce its judgement on the role of BJP leaders LK Advani, MM Joshi and Uma Bharti in the Babri masjid demolition.

4. Rahul launches fresh attack on govt over Rafale deal; BJP hits back

Congress leader Rahul Gandhi on Saturday made a fresh attack on the government over the Rafale fighter aircraft deal, prompting Union Minister Piyush Goyal to hit back saying he is welcome to fight the 2024 general elections on the issue.

5. Tablighi foreigners were made scapegoats, says court

In a significant verdict, the Bombay High Court has said that there is a possibility that Tablighis who attended the Markaz in Delhi were "chosen to make them scapegoats" and slammed the media propaganda attempting to blame them for spreading Covid-19 in India.

6. Pak sanctions 88 terrorists including Taliban, Hafiz to avoid FATF blacklist

In a bid to avoid a demotion from the Financial Action Task Force's (FATF) grey list to the blacklist during the upcoming October plenary meeting, Pakistan on Friday imposed sanctions on more than 88 terrorists associated with different terrorist groups, including Jamaat-ud-Dawa (JuD), JeM, Taliban, and al-Qaeda, media reports said.

7. Explained: Why is Sakshi Malik urging for Arjuna Award?

Khel Ratna Award winner and Olympic bronze medallist Sakshi Malik's name was left out of the final list of athletes to be honoured with Arjuna Award in 2020.

8. IPL 14 to start in April 2021, confirms Sourav Ganguly

After hosting IPL 13 in UAE, BCCI has decided that the mega event will return to India in 2021 for its 14th edition.

9. AGR dues: SC seeks detailed affidavit from DoT on dues to be paid by users of shared spectrum

The Supreme Court on Friday, while hearing the adjusted gross revenue (AGR) payment matter, asked the Department of Telecommunications (DoT), Secretary, to file a detailed affidavit on the issue of the dues to be paid by the users of shared spectrum.

10. CBI, Mumbai Police arrive at Sushant's Bandra flat, with Pithani, cook

The Special Investigation Team of the CBI probing the death of Sushant Singh Rajput on Saturday reached the Bandra flat of the actor, where he was found dead on June 14.
